Get Access To All JobsTips for Finding OPT Sponsorship as a Sales Account Manager
Target industries with consistent OPT sponsorship history
SaaS companies, enterprise software firms, and B2B technology providers have the strongest track record of sponsoring OPT for sales roles. Prioritize companies with 200-plus employees where structured sales teams and dedicated HR make sponsorship more routine.
Lead with quota attainment and pipeline numbers
Hiring managers in sales evaluate candidates on revenue impact, not just tasks. Quantify your internship or academic project outcomes with specific metrics. Numbers make your resume stand out and signal you understand what the role actually requires.
Clarify your OPT authorization early in the process
State your OPT status and authorization end date clearly in applications. Employers appreciate transparency over surprises late in interviews. Framing it as 12 to 36 months of work authorization reduces hesitation and positions you as a lower-risk hire.
Pursue STEM OPT extension if your degree qualifies
If your degree is in a STEM-designated field like computer information systems or quantitative business, apply for the 24-month extension before your initial OPT expires. This extends your total authorization to 36 months and gives employers longer H-1B visa planning runway.
Build your pipeline before OPT starts, not after
Start applying three to four months before your OPT start date. Sales hiring cycles run four to eight weeks, and you want offers in hand before your window opens. Late starts compress your runway and limit negotiating leverage significantly.
Prepare a concise OPT explainer for sales managers
Sales hiring managers often lack immigration familiarity. Have a one-paragraph explanation ready: what OPT is, how long it lasts, what it costs the employer (nothing upfront), and when H-1B sponsorship would become relevant. Removing ambiguity accelerates their decision-making.
Sales Account Manager OPT: Frequently Asked Questions
Can I work as a Sales Account Manager on OPT?
Yes, Sales Account Manager roles are eligible for OPT work authorization as long as the position is directly related to your degree field. A business, marketing, communications, or related degree typically satisfies this requirement. You'll need to ensure your EAD card is approved and your SEVIS record is updated before your start date.
Do Sales Account Manager employers typically sponsor OPT students?
Many do, particularly in SaaS, enterprise technology, and B2B services. Sales roles at growth-stage and mid-market tech companies often have high turnover and active hiring pipelines, which makes OPT candidates attractive. Does a Sales Account Manager role qualify for the STEM OPT extension?
It depends on your degree, not the job title. Sales Account Manager roles don't automatically trigger STEM OPT eligibility. If your undergraduate or graduate degree is in a STEM-designated field, such as management information systems, data analytics, or computer science, you may qualify for the 24-month extension regardless of your job title.
What happens to my OPT if I lose my Sales Account Manager job?
You have a 60-day unemployment grace period after your position ends. During that window, you can job search, accept a new offer, and update your SEVIS record with your DSO. Time spent unemployed counts against the 90-day unemployment limit for OPT, so starting your job search immediately is important.
Can I work as an independent sales contractor on OPT?
Self-employment and independent contracting on OPT are allowed, but the rules are strict. USCIS requires that you work for yourself in a role directly related to your degree, and you cannot work as a contractor for a single company in a way that functions like regular employment. Most OPT students in sales pursue full-time W-2 employment to stay clearly within compliance boundaries.
